The driver manager in system settings offers 3 graphics drivers;
- nvidia 352 (recommended)
- nvidia 352-updates
- x.org nouveau display driver

I have tried with all three drivers (with a reboot between changes) and the freeze-on-shutdown symptoms occur with each of the nvidia drivers, but not (so far) with the x.org driver.
Of course, the x.org driver struggles a bit to run my dual monitor setup, but at least it is good to know that I can properly shutdown the system when I want to.
